Run Google Ads Search Campaigns

Step-by-step

  1. Create a new Search campaign in Google Ads with your objective (Leads or Sales).
  2. Structure the campaign: create separate ad groups for each keyword theme (product features, competitor comparisons, pain points).
  3. Write Responsive Search Ads: provide 8-15 unique headlines and 3-4 descriptions. Include keywords in headlines, benefits in descriptions.
  4. Pin critical headlines: if a specific headline must always show (e.g., your brand name or main CTA), pin it to position 1.
  5. Set up ad extensions: add sitelinks (4-6 links to key pages), callouts (trust signals like '500+ customers'), and structured snippets.
  6. Add call extensions if you want phone leads, and location extensions for local businesses.
  7. Set bid adjustments by device: if mobile converts differently than desktop, adjust bids accordingly.
  8. Launch with a moderate budget and monitor the first week's performance closely.
  9. Optimize weekly: pause low-performing keywords (high spend, no conversions), increase bids on winners, add new negative keywords.
  10. Track quality scores: optimize ad relevance and landing page experience to lower CPCs. Quality Score 7+ is the target.
